Let us discuss another Splunk application. We referred to a Splunk app that integrates log parser. We will discuss it a little bit more today
Log parser search queries as we know are SQL queries where as Splunk takes unix like search operators. Moreover Splunk exposes a query language for its indexed data whereas log parser can work with a variety of data sources.  They say data is sticky meaning that users like to use the same applications that they have been using for their data unless there is a compelling advantage or the cost and risk to move the data is negligible. In order that Splunk may work with the data that belonged to log parser,  let us look into query translation to log parser so that we can avoid the data import.
